'Man seeks individualism because he seeks self-consciousness, but later he learns that the way to God-consciousness is through the group. You think of yourselves as individuals, as monads, because you are learning expression on the outer plane; but, my brethren, you have yet to learn that you are part of a group. You, the individual, we liken to the proton, and around you circulate the electrons.

You must open your consciousness to this divine cosmic reality. You are nothing. Of yourselves you can do nothing. You cannot live alone. You have many selves, many personalities. You belong to your group, and your group belongs to many other groups, which form a community: and that community belongs to many other communities which form a sphere, and so on and on.

Every man or woman who thinks that he or she is separate and lives with this thought of self-life is living in darkness. Humanity is learning by the hard way this truth of group life, of brotherhood, of co-operation, and expansion of the little consciousness into the God-consciousness. The only way you can realise this is through pure love.

Look up into the heavens and see this truth demonstrated in the myriad stars...

I am nothing...

Yet I am all, when I recognise all.'

This was the passage I opened up first to read to my mother 24 hours before she died. I read to her half of the Meditation book by White Eagle during her last hours. I believe these words brought her great comfort. For me, they are the truest words I've ever read. I hope you enjoy them as much as I cherish them.
